Why Ultra-High Voltage Failures Occur in UPS Inverters
UPS inverters are critical for maintaining stable power supply in industries like renewable energy, manufacturing, and data centers. However, ultra-high voltage output failures can disrupt operations, damage equipment, and increase maintenance costs. Let's break down the common causes:
- Component Aging: Capacitors or transistors degrade over time, leading to voltage spikes.
- Load Imbalance: Sudden power surges from connected devices destabilize the inverter.
- Software Glitches: Firmware errors may miscalculate voltage regulation parameters.

How to Diagnose and Fix Ultra-High Voltage Issues
Diagnosing these failures requires a mix of hardware checks and software analytics. Here's a step-by-step approach:
- Use a multimeter to measure output voltage during peak loads.
- Inspect capacitors for bulging or leakage.
- Update inverter firmware to the latest stable version.

FAQs: UPS Inverter Voltage Failures
Q: How often should I test my UPS inverter's voltage output? A: Test monthly under varying load conditions and after any major system updates.
Q: Can solar panel configurations affect inverter voltage stability? A: Absolutely. Mismatched strings or shading issues often create voltage imbalances.
